What You'll Do

As a Veterinary Technician at Veterinary Specialty Center, you will play an important role throughout the surgical patient’s experience, from preparation and anesthesia through recovery and discharge.

Responsibilities may include:

  • IV catheter placement and venipuncture
  • Preparing patients for surgical procedures
  • Anesthesia preparation and monitoring
  • Monitoring patients during surgical procedures
  • Post-anesthesia monitoring and recovery
  • Medication administration
  • Hospitalized patient nursing and monitoring
  • Patient restraint and safe handling
  • Assisting with advanced diagnostic and surgical procedures
  • Maintaining accurate medical records
  • Preparing and maintaining the surgical and treatment areas
  • Communicating closely with veterinarians and the patient-care team
